G9731 is a HCPCS Level II code for patient unable to complete the lepf prom at initial evaluation and/or discharge due to blindness, illiteracy, severe mental incapacity or language incompatibility and an adequate proxy is not available. It belongs to the Procedures and Professional Services (Temporary) section. Whether Medicare pays it depends on the coverage rule below.

Medicare coverage: Carrier judgment

Coverage is decided by your Medicare contractor, not by national policy. Whether this is paid depends on the LCD for your jurisdiction and on what the documentation supports.

From the coverage field of the CMS Alpha-Numeric HCPCS File, release 2026Q3-Jul. This states Medicare’s position on the code, not on your particular claim.

Physician fee schedule statusM

Measurement code. Used for reporting purposes only; never paid.

Global period: XXX
